The Short Answer
The reason why 60 degree air is so much more comfortable than 60 degree water is that water is about 25 times as thermally conductive as air is. This means that water at any temperature transmits its heat (or absorbs yours) 25 times more quickly than air of the same temperature. It is this reason why it is possible to sit in a 240 degree sauna for 20 minutes, while water at 120 degrees can cause burns within a couple of minutes. Conductivity. Edit: Whoops, yup! According to [this](_URL_0_) the thermal conductivity of water is 0.58 W/(m.K) at 25-degrees C, while air is 0.024 W/(m.K) at the same temp. 0.58 / 0.024 == @25. Not 8, as I said previously.
